Welcome to Maple Grove ...

Maple Grove is located in Manitowoc County<1>.


The location of Maple Grove has been provided by the Geographic Names Information System (ie- the GNIS).<2>


A typical abbreviation for Maple Grove: Maple Grv.

Maple Grove is 890 feet [271 m] above sea level.<3>.

Time Zone: Maple Grove lies in the Central Time Zone (CST/CDT) and observes daylight saving time

Area codes for Maple Grove: (920) & (274)<4>

Communities Also Named Maple Grove ...

Using our Gazetteer, we found that there are two Wisconsin communities named Maple Grove: This one is located in Manitowoc County and the other is located in La Crosse County.

Beyond Wisconsin, there are 72 communities that are also named Maple Grove - they are located in Alabama, Arkansas, California, Colorado, Georgia (2), Illinois (2), Iowa, Kansas (3), Kentucky, Maine, Maryland, Massachusetts, Michigan (6), Minnesota, Missouri, New Brunswick, New Jersey, New York (6), North Carolina, Nova Scotia, Ohio (7), Ontario (7), Oregon, Pennsylvania (8), Quebec (3), South Dakota, Tennessee (4), Utah, Virginia (4) and Washington.
